How do online lessons work?

Our online classroom has everything your child needs for a great lesson, including a video chat, an interactive whiteboard, and a way to share documents. All they need is a laptop or computer with a webcam and a stable internet connection.

How often should my child have a lesson?

Most families find that one hour-long lesson per week is ideal for making steady progress. However, you can arrange lessons as often as you feel your child needs them, especially in the run-up to exams.
